Picked up this jointer recently at an estate sale. Don't have a jointer so I figured it was something to mess with and give it a whirl. Reviews aren't the hottest on this benchtop model but it didn't cost me much. Figuring whomever had it first would've worked out any bugs. My question is, it didn't come with the guard that goes over the top spinning head, so other than just not sticking my fingers in it, anything else I need to be aware of? I tried looking online and it seems that part is discontinued and no place had it for sale that I could buy.

It is on ebay right now from Sears Parts Direct for $28.63 plus shipping I believe the part number is N030463. It is actually the whole assembly with guard,spring and mounting bracket. Make no mistake, that blade can chop you up really bad. Use pusher blocks to feed.
